Sp. Sovilj et al., Dinuclear copper(II) complexes of N,N ',N '',N '''-tetrakis(2-pyridylmethyl)-1,4,8,11-tetraazacyclotetradecane and some N,S or N,O bidentate ligands, POL J CHEM, 74(7), 2000, pp. 945-954
Four new mixed complexes of Cu(II) with tpmc (N,N',N ",N"'-tetrakis(2-pyrid
ylmethyl)-1,4,8,11-tetraazacyclotetradecane) and bridged bound N,S or N,O l
igands of the general formula [Cu-2(X)tpmc](ClO4)(4), where X = thiosemicar
bazide (tsc), semicarbazide (sc), thiourea (tu) or urea (II), were prepared
. Elemental and thermal analyses, conductometric and magnetic measurements,
electronic, IR and mass spectroscopy have been employed. The molar conduct
ivity values in acetonitrile show a behavior of 1:4 electrolytes. IR studie
s clearly indicate that X ligand is coordinated via N, S (tsc and tu) or N,
O (se and II) atoms, acting as bidentate bridging ligands. An exo coordina
tion of Cu(II) ions and tpmc was proposed. Thermal decomposition of the com
plexes was performed. The mass decomposition pathways are proposed. Finally
, the obtained complexes exhibit microbiological activity against some bact
eria.
